The Regional Physician Health and Safety Working Groups (RPHSWG) have been formally established by the Memorandum of Agreement on Physical and Psychological Health and Safety (2025 PHS Agreement) was negotiated as part of the 2025 Physician Main Agreement. The 2025 PHS Agreement outlines expanded support for the physical and psychological health and safety for physicians. This includes a working group in each health authority to engage on matters of importance regarding regional physician health and safety.
It was recognized that structures and processes for physicians regarding physical and psychological safety vary considerably across the province. In some cases, these processes do not exist at all. The 2025 PHS Agreement seeks to continue rebuild many of these processes so that physicians are better supported and protected in their work environment.
The responsibilities of the Working Group are to:
- Identify, review and discuss issues related to health and safety within the region or individual sites;
- Approve projects and initiatives in alignment with its Terms of Reference;
- Review health and safety policies and procedures and make recommendations to Provincial Level Working Groups and the Health Authority;
- Share statistical data and de-identified aggregate data between the Health Authorities and the Doctors of BC; and
- Consult and engage with the Health Authority to support the delivery of key information to the department and individual level. Key information may include effective reporting of critical tracking information, policy or process changes and progress on the implementation of elements of the Canadian Standards Association standard regionally and for specific sites.
